K2M Design is looking for positive contributors to our culture, that are passionate about meeting the demanding needs of our clients, and add value and impact through expertise - all in turn contributing to the growth of K2M.

If you are an AEC Senior Mechanical Engineer and believe in Building Relationships Based on Trust and Results - we need you! Position is fully remote for the right candidate.

Position Summary: A Licensed Engineer who uses experience to perform a variety of assignments requiring skills in all aspects of engineering design for large and complex projects, serving as an SME on areas of expertise.

Core Competencies

  • Design Vision. Able to visualize and capture a client’s imagination of their space.
  • High Standards. Leads by example and holds the team accountable to the same.
  • Problem Solver. Resolves conflict. Seeks and finds solutions to meet team and organizational needs.
  • Organized. Plans, coordinates, and budgets in an efficient and effective manner.
  • Composed. Maintains performance under pressure and stress.
  • Communication. Clear and concise, written and verbal language skills.
  • Ability to Delegate. Empowers team member’s skills through challenging and interesting tasks.
  • Integrity. Leads by example and holds the team accountable to the same.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Provides professional engineering consultation in the planning, design, and coordination of large, complex projects.
  • Acts as liaison with Project Management, Architects, other Engineers, and consultants.
  • Carries out complex or novel assignments requiring the development of new or improved techniques and procedures.
  • Develops and represents the lead technical viewpoint on projects.
  • Coordinates with Director on appropriate technical solutions and product strategies.
  • Coordinates activities and provides developmental support/training to less experienced staff.
  • Uses skills to resolve conflicting design requirements.
  • Provides QA/QC review of deliverables.
  • Prepares reports and client correspondence on assigned projects.
  • Travels for client meetings, consultant coordination, site surveys, construction administration, etc. 15% of time reserved for travel.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Applied Science from an ABET accredited college or university.
  • 15+ years experience in the field of AEC Engineering.
  • Professional Engineering License, required.
  • Position only available to candidates residing in EST and CST time zones.
